## Changelog — Font vendoring defaults changed

As of this release, the Bracken UI build no longer fetches third-party fonts at build time. All typefaces used by the Lanternwell suite are now vendored into the repo under a dedicated assets directory, and the fetch step is skipped by default. If you're onboarding, nothing to install — the fonts travel with the checkout. The build flags controlling this behavior are listed below.

settings of hadup-yafog:
LAMAEL_PIN=3761
LAMAEL_TENANT=istmir
LAMAEL_METRICS_HOST=metrics.lamael.plorvasys.test
LAMAEL_SEAL=seal_8ea68500
LAMAEL_STANDBY_TEAM=fraok

**Action item (Ketterby incident #owner: tile team):** The prefetcher hammered the Ashvale tile store after cache flush. Add rate limiting and a warmup ramp before next release. Page thresholds unchanged. Verify staging soak for 24h. The prefetcher tuning constants to deploy are below.

tuning constants:
QUOTAS = {
    "druwyn": 5,
    "holix": 5,
    "zorath": 5,
    "holwyn": 10,
}

**Key Ceremony Checklist — Item 7 (Grainview Diff Tools)**

☐ Rotate the signing key used by the Grainview large-file diff viewer plugin API. External plugin authors must re-sign their chunk-streaming extensions against the new key within 30 days; older signatures will be rejected by the viewer's loader. Confirm the escrow officer has witnessed the rotation and sealed the envelope. Once both witnesses initial this item, append the recovery passphrase directly beneath this line.

unlock words, hahip-baduf: holwyn-istath-julvan

## Authentication

The Marrowfen ledger service partitions its tables by month; queries must include a month range or they are rejected. Support staff can read any partition from the last twelve months but cannot write. All requests go through the internal gateway with header-based auth. Tokens rotate quarterly. For read access during ticket triage, use the key below.

API key for yahig-tadup: kto7_ubizbYm